Case 2: Squamous Cell Carcinoma in Organ Transplant Recipient
Patient Presentation
Demographics: 58-year-old male
Chief Complaint: Rapidly growing nodule on left forearm
History of Present Illness: The patient noticed a small scaly patch on his forearm 6 months ago. Over the past 2 months, it has rapidly enlarged into a firm nodule. It is now 2.5 cm, tender, and occasionally bleeds. He received a kidney transplant 8 years ago and is on chronic immunosuppression.
Past Medical History:
- Kidney transplant 8 years ago
- Chronic immunosuppression: Tacrolimus, mycophenolate, prednisone
- Multiple actinic keratoses (treated with cryotherapy)
- History of two prior SCCs (excised)
Physical Examination:
- Left forearm:
- 2.5 cm firm, indurated nodule
- Central ulceration with keratinous crust
- Surrounding erythema
- Adherent to underlying tissue
- Regional lymphadenopathy (left epitrochlear node palpable)
Workup and Results
Excisional Biopsy:
- Invasive squamous cell carcinoma
- Moderately differentiated
- Depth: 6 mm
- Perineural invasion present
- Margins positive
Staging Workup:
- CT scan: Suspicious 2 cm epitrochlear lymph node
- Fine needle aspiration: Metastatic SCC

Diagnosis
High-Risk Squamous Cell Carcinoma with Nodal Metastasis
High-risk features present:
- Size >2 cm
- Depth >6 mm
- Perineural invasion
- Immunosuppression
- Regional lymph node metastasis
Discussion
This case illustrates SCC in immunosuppressed patients:
- Transplant Recipients at High Risk: The lecture states that organ transplant recipients have a 65-fold increased risk for SCC. This is due to chronic immunosuppression and impaired immune surveillance.
- Actinic Keratosis Precursor: The lecture identifies actinic keratosis as a precursor lesion for SCC, with 1-10% progressing to invasive SCC.
- Perineural Invasion: The lecture notes that perineural invasion is a high-risk feature associated with increased metastasis and local recurrence.
- Anti-PD-1 Therapy: The lecture identifies anti-PD-1 immunotherapy (cemiplimab, pembrolizumab) as first-line treatment for advanced/metastatic SCC. However, use in transplant recipients requires careful consideration of rejection risk.
Treatment Plan
- Surgical Management:
- Wide local excision with adequate margins (Mohs or standard excision)
- Lymph node dissection for confirmed nodal disease
- Adjuvant Therapy:
- Consider adjuvant radiation to primary site and nodal basin
- Discussion with transplant team about immunosuppression modification
- Immunotherapy Consideration:
- Cemiplimab or pembrolizumab for advanced disease
- CAUTION: Risk of transplant rejection with checkpoint inhibitors
- Requires multidisciplinary discussion
- Immunosuppression Modification:
- Consider conversion to sirolimus (mTOR inhibitor)
- May have antiproliferative effects
- Surveillance:
- Frequent skin exams (every 3 months)
- Field therapy for actinic keratoses (5-FU, imiquimod, PDT)
Teaching Points
- Organ transplant recipients have 65-fold increased SCC risk
- Actinic keratosis is a precursor to SCC (1-10% progress)
- Perineural invasion increases metastasis and recurrence risk
- Anti-PD-1 immunotherapy is first-line for advanced SCC
- Field cancerization requires field-directed therapy (5-FU, imiquimod, PDT)
